    Captured and edited PAL footage into FCP with IO LA into a PAL FCP sequence. Is it possible to successfully send out signal to an NTSC machine for record? Preliminary tests are not suxxessful.

    I do not think the io is a standards converter, but you can use a filter from Graeme Nattress that will convert your PAL timeline to NTSC. I’ve done this before (except from NTSC to PAL) and it works great. http://www.nattress.com Click on the standards conversion tab. The render times might take a while depending on length of your program and your machine, but it’s well worth it to have the control.

    I’d suggest putting it on a PAL tape and sending it out for the NTSC conversion. Its easier, faster, better and probably cheaper in most cases.
